* [PATCH] net: usb: smsc95xx: Limit packet length to skb->len

Packet length retrieved from skb data may be larger than
the actual socket buffer length (up to 1526 bytes). In such
case the cloned skb passed up the network stack will leak
kernel memory contents.

diff --git a/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c b/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
index 32d2c60d3..ba766bdb2 100644
--- a/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
+++ b/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
@@ -1851,7 +1851,8 @@ static int smsc95xx_rx_fixup(struct usbnet *dev, struct sk_buff *skb)
}
} else {
/* ETH_FRAME_LEN + 4(CRC) + 2(COE) + 4(Vlan) */
- if (unlikely(size > (ETH_FRAME_LEN + 12))) {
+ if (unlikely(size > (ETH_FRAME_LEN + 12) ||
+ size > skb->len)) {
netif_dbg(dev, rx_err, dev->net,
"size err header=0x%08x\n", header);
return 0;

On Mon, 13 Mar 2023 23:01:24 +0100 Szymon Heidrich wrote:
> Packet length retrieved from skb data may be larger than
nit: s/skb data/descriptor/ may be better in terms of terminology
> the actual socket buffer length (up to 1526 bytes). In such
nit: the "up to 1526 bytes" is a bit confusing, I'd remove it.
> case the cloned skb passed up the network stack will leak
> kernel memory contents.
> Fixes: 2f7ca802bdae ("net: Add SMSC LAN9500 USB2.0 10/100 ethernet adapter driver")
> Signed-off-by: Szymon Heidrich <szymon.heidrich@gmail.com>
> ---
> dr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c | 3 ++-
> 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c b/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
> index 32d2c60d3..ba766bdb2 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
> @@ -1851,7 +1851,8 @@ static int smsc95xx_rx_fixup(struct usbnet *dev, struct sk_buff *skb)
> }
> } else {
> /* ETH_FRAME_LEN + 4(CRC) + 2(COE) + 4(Vlan) */
> - if (unlikely(size > (ETH_FRAME_LEN + 12))) {
> + if (unlikely(size > (ETH_FRAME_LEN + 12) ||
> + size > skb->len)) {
We need this check on both sides of the big if {} statement.
In case the error bit is set and we drop the packet we still
end up in skb_pull() which if size > skb->len will panic the
kernel.
So let's do this check right after size and align are calculated?
The patch for smsc75xx has sadly already been applied so you'll
need to prepare a fix to the fix :(

* [PATCH v2] net: usb: smsc95xx: Limit packet length to skb->len

Packet length retrieved from descriptor may be larger than
the actual socket buffer length. In such case the cloned
skb passed up the network stack will leak kernel memory contents.
Fixes: 2f7ca802bdae ("net: Add SMSC LAN9500 USB2.0 10/100 ethernet adapter driver")
Signed-off-by: Szymon Heidrich <szymon.heidrich@gmail.com>
---
V1 -> V2: Move packet length check to prevent kernel panic in skb_pull
dr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c | 6 ++++++
1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c b/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
index 32d2c60d3..563ecd27b 100644
--- a/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
+++ b/drivers/net/usb/smsc95xx.c
@@ -1833,6 +1833,12 @@ static int smsc95xx_rx_fixup(struct usbnet *dev, struct sk_buff *skb)
size = (u16)((header & RX_STS_FL_) >> 16);
align_count = (4 - ((size + NET_IP_ALIGN) % 4)) % 4;
+ if (unlikely(size > skb->len)) {
+ netif_dbg(dev, rx_err, dev->net,
+ "size err header=0x%08x\n", header);
+ return 0;
+ }
+
if (unlikely(header & RX_STS_ES_)) {
netif_dbg(dev, rx_err, dev->net,
"Error header=0x%08x\n", header);
